I have no use for a glass roof and much prefer the headroom and the $1500 savings. The fact that I could get a heated steering wheel as a standalone option in New England was nearly a deal breaker! Like many manufacturers, Mazda forced me into a sunroof trim to get this feature. The infotainment system is easier in the Ford and the brakes are much stronger. I like the additional headroom and knee room, and the seats are as good as the CX. However the Edge has more body and storage space … due to a less sloping design. The gas mileage is a tad better given the slightly smaller size. The drivetrain and across the range torque feel nearly identical to the Mazda. ![]() It has met or exceeded my expectations relative to the fine CX9 in every way.
